8 less than the product 13 times a number x is less than or equal to -32.

13x-8≤-32 would be the answer.
You have a product of 13 and a number x (which would be 13x) and you subtract 8 from it (this is because "8 less than the product of 13 and a number x"). The reason for the 
≤-32 part should be easy to figure out, it's right there in the problem :-)
